Ext Tree实例:数据库增删改查操作方法

版权申诉
0 下载量 94 浏览量 更新于2024-11-13 收藏 862KB RAR 举报
资源摘要信息:"ext-tree.rar_ext_ext tr_ext tre_ext.tr_ext.tree" 描述中提到的关键知识点是关于"ext"这一术语,以及树(tree)的操作实例。"Ext"在这里很可能是指Ext JS(又名Sencha ExtJS),这是一个主要用于构建跨浏览器的交互式web应用程序的JavaScript框架。Ext JS提供了丰富的用户界面组件和一个强大的数据处理机制,允许开发者通过面向对象的方法来组织和管理代码。 在Ext JS中,树形(Tree)控件是一个常用组件,它可以用来显示层次化数据,通常用于表示具有父子关系的信息结构。开发者可以通过右键菜单(context menu)对树节点进行操作,实现对数据库的增删改查(CRUD)功能。增删改查是指创建(Create)、读取(Read)、更新(Update)、删除(Delete)数据库记录的基本操作。 在描述中没有直接提到数据库的具体类型,但是右键菜单操作树节点与数据库交互通常需要使用AJAX技术来异步请求服务器上的资源。这通常涉及使用Ext JS内置的数据包(例如Ext.data.Store和Ext.data.Proxy)来处理数据,以及配置相应的模型(Ext.data.Model)来表示数据记录。 标签部分提供了关键词"ext"、"ext_tr"、"ext_tre"、"ext.tr"和"ext.tree"。这些关键词中的"ext"指代Ext JS框架;"ext_tr"、"ext_tre"、"ext.tr"和"ext.tree"可能是指与Ext JS框架中的树形控件相关的特定功能或模块。例如,"ext.tree"可能指的是Ext JS框架中树形控件的模块,而".tr"和"_tre"可能是指该模块中的特定文件或组件。 压缩包子文件的文件名称列表中包含了两个文件:一个是"***.txt",这个文件名暗示了一个文本文件,可能包含了网址(***),而***是知名的程序代码下载网站,所以这个文件可能包含了从该网站下载的代码、说明或者其他信息。另一个文件是"ext-tree",根据文件标题,这很可能是一个包含Ext JS树形控件代码实例的压缩文件。尽管文件后缀是.rar,这表明它是一个压缩包,用户需要使用适当的解压缩工具来提取其中的内容。 解压缩后,我们可能发现"ext-tree"文件包含了JavaScript文件、HTML模板、CSS样式表,以及可能的数据库连接文件,这些都是实现树形控件与数据库交互所必需的。通过分析这些文件,开发者可以更深入地了解Ext JS框架如何操作树形控件,并且如何通过用户界面与数据库进行交云。理解这些知识点对于进行Web前端开发以及构建动态网站界面尤为重要。